

Overview :
The Tecnifibre T-FIGHT 285 is the ultimate blend of power, control, and manoeuvrability, designed for competitive and regular players who demand high performance. Weighing 285g, this racket delivers a solid swing weight while remaining highly manoeuvrable. The 645 cm² (100 in²) head size and 16×19 string pattern maximise power and spin potential, catering to the fast-paced demands of modern tennis.
Tennis Staff / Pro Review :
The T-FIGHT 285is the perfect racket for aggressive baseliners who want the ability to generate spin and power effortlessly while maintaining control on precision shots. The RS Section frame provides the stability needed for clean ball striking, while the manoeuvrable weight distribution allows for quick swings and easy racket head acceleration. Players who thrive on dictating rallies with spin-heavy forehands and aggressive backhands will appreciate the modern feel and responsiveness of this racket.

Strung or Unstrung? | Strung |
---|---|
Weight Unstrung (+/- 5g) | 285 |
Head Size (sq. in) | 100 |
Balance (+/- 5mm) | 320 mm |
String Pattern | 16x19 |
Length (inches) | 27 |
Composition | Graphite |
